The job of Attendance Specialist is done for the purpose/s of registering children; collecting and maintaining student attendance information at the assigned site; meeting district, state and federal requirements relating to attendance processes including parent notification; preparing and distributing attendance reports and materials; providing clerical support at school site; and communicating various information regarding activities.
Essential Functions- Communicates with parents, students, staff, etc. in person, by telephone or letter for the purpose of providing information on a variety of attendance issues and meeting district and state absence notification requirements.
- Compiles student records (e.g. birth certificates, transfers, immunizations, etc.) for the purpose of meeting state, federal and/or district requirements.
- Ensures accuracy of attendance records, including verification of forgeries and truancies and/or signing students in/out for the purpose of complying with State laws governing attendance accounting.
- Evaluates situations (e.g. involving other staff, students, parents, the public, police, probation department, etc.) for the purpose of taking appropriate action and/or directing to appropriate personnel for resolution.
- Maintains a variety of attendance records, schedules, and files (manual and computer) (e.g. contact and telephone logs, student attendance, cash receipts, etc.) for the purpose of documenting and/or providing reliable information.
- Performs enrollment and un-enrollment activities (e.g. updating automated student information system, preparing permanent student record and cumulative folders, etc.) for the purpose of ensuring compliance with financial, legal, state or federal requirements.
- Prepares a variety of reports and written materials (e.g. passes, standardized and special attendance reports, letters to parents, etc.) for the purpose of conveying information regarding school and/or district activities and procedures.
- Processes documents and materials (e.g. attendance records, student placement, disciplinary and/or suspension notices, homework requests, etc.) for the purpose of complying with local, state and federal attendance requirements.
- Responds to inquiries from a variety of individuals (e.g. staff, parents, students, etc.) for the purpose of providing information and/or direction.
- Screens telephone calls for the purpose of directing to appropriate personnel and/or taking messages.
- Assists other personnel for the purpose of supporting them in the completion of their work activities.
